Ingredients

  • Avocados: 400g (weighed after removing shell and seed)
  • Ong Tho Nha Condensed Milk: 380g
  • Unsweetened Fresh Milk: 1 liter
  • Natural Flavored Yogurt (Starter): 2 jars
  • Sugar: 100g

Step-by-Step Instructions

Step 1. Prepare Ingredients and Sterilize

  • Sterilize jars and utensils with hot water and sun-dry them. This is crucial for successful yogurt incubation.
  • Peel and pit the avocados. Cut into small pieces for easier blending.

Step 2. Blend and Heat the Avocado Mixture

  • Blend avocados with 500ml fresh milk and sugar until smooth.
  • Add the remaining 500ml of fresh milk and blend again until smooth.
  • Pour the mixture into a pot. Add condensed milk and stir well.
  • Heat the mixture gently until warm (around 40 degrees Celsius). Do not boil. This activates the yogurt starter.

Step 3. Inoculate and Incubate

  • Add the yogurt starter (2 jars) and stir well.
  • Pour the mixture into the sterilized jars.
  • Incubate in a steamer with boiling water (1-1.5 liters) for 12 hours. Maintain a stable position for successful incubation.

Step 4. Chill and Serve

  • After 12 hours, refrigerate the yogurt.

Tips

  • Use ripe avocados for best flavor; avoid bitter ones.
  • Use Ong Tho Nha condensed milk for a creamier, more successful result.
  • Don't boil the milk mixture; gently warm it to activate the yogurt starter.
  • Ensure jars are completely dry before pouring in the yogurt mixture.
  • Use a steamer for fast and successful incubation. Avoid moving the steamer during incubation.

FAQs

1. Can I use any type of avocado?

Ripe avocados are key! Choose avocados that yield slightly to gentle pressure. Hass avocados work best for their creamy texture.

2. What kind of yogurt is best?

Plain Greek yogurt is recommended for its thickness and tang, but you can experiment with other types, adjusting sweetness as needed.

3. How can I make it sweeter?

Add a touch of honey, maple syrup, or a sprinkle of sugar to taste. A little goes a long way!
